To RHC.{R. H. Coverley - Production Engineer} from Hs{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air}/Gry.{Shadwell Grylls} Hs{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air}/Gry{Shadwell Grylls}:1/KT. 28.8.33. 20/25 CLUTCH SLIP. You will remember suggesting that in order to ensure the correct pitchline slack in the serrations of the clutch pressure plate, a complete circular gauge should be used. It is thought that testing each tooth separately is inadequate. Will you send us a drawing of a suitable gauge so that one can be made for the Repair Dept. and N. We do not need one ourselves as all our clutches have the new parallel splines. Hs{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air}/Gry.{Shadwell Grylls} | ||
